About Erin R. Steenblock

Erin R. Steenblock is a scholar working on Immunology, Bioengineering and Microbiology, having authored 8 papers that have together received 556 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(4 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(3 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(282 citations), Oncology (201 citations) and Biomaterials (67 citations). Erin R. Steenblock has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Tarek M. Fahmy, Tarek R. Fadel, Eric Stern, M. Labowsky, Jordan S. Pober, Mark A. Reed, Stephen H. Wrzesinski, Richard A. Flavell, Ji‐Seon Kim and Kevin G. Rice.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Nano Letters and Analytical Biochemistry.
